fsDhcp6SrvPoolPreference
ARICENT-DHCPv6-SERVER-MIB ·
.1.3.6.1.4.1.29601.2.42.2.1.1.3
Object
column r/w
Integer32
The object indicates the preference value of the pool. This value is used by client to select the best information when it receives multiple reply messages from different servers. The default value is zero means lowest Preference pool.
